Hello! My name is Tim, and I graduated magna cum laude from the University of Illinois at Chicago (2023) with a Bachelor’s Degree in History and Political Science. I hold a Master of Arts in Teaching from National Louis University (2025) and I am currently pursuing a Master’s in Political Science at the University of Illinois Springfield. I am a licensed high school teacher in English and Social Studies, with K–12 endorsements in Special Education and ESL. Over the past five years working in education, I have supported students at the high school and college levels, focusing on academic growth, confidence building, and long-term success.

I tutor a variety of subjects including ACT English, ACT Reading, SAT Reading, Government & Politics, Political Science, Grammar, Reading, Writing, Vocabulary, American History, Elementary Math, Pre-Algebra, Algebra 1, Linear Algebra, Geography, and ASVAB, on which I earned a perfect score of 99. I also have a strong record in standardized testing, earning a 35 in ACT English, 33 in ACT Reading, and a perfect SAT Writing score, along with AP scores of 5 in U.S. History, 5 in U.S. Government, 5 in Language & Composition, and 4 in Literature. These experiences allow me to teach both essential academic content and effective test-taking strategies such as pacing, reasoning, and organization.

In addition to teaching and tutoring, I coach high school soccer, which has strengthened my ability to motivate students, build strong relationships, and create structured plans that support individual strengths and goals. I am committed to building a positive, encouraging learning environment where students feel supported and confident.

My tutoring approach focuses on developing confidence that leads to academic independence. I break material down clearly, personalize instruction based on learning style, and aim to help students build skills they can apply long after tutoring ends.
